Re: Can this pump really transfer 1380 litres/min
« Reply #4 on: August 30, 2016, 10:00:48 PM »
The plate says 1/min not l/min.
That's the motor speed (= RPM)

Just looking at it's size, you can tell it wouldn't fill an IBC in c. 40 seconds...
